#d10928 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d10928 is composed of 82% red, 3.5%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.7% magenta, 80.9%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 350.7 degrees, a saturation of 91.7% and a lightness of 42.7%. #d10928 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ff1250 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

● #d10928 color description : Strong red.
#d10928 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d10928 has RGB values of R:209, G:9,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.96, Y:0.81,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13699368.
